cromniomancy (s) (noun) (no pl)
A prophecy by using onions or their sprouts: Cromniomancy is a divination by the way of names, significant happenings, or missing persons written on onions, planted, and observed to see which one would sprout first.

The onion which sprouted most rapidly indicated that the person whose name had been inscribed on it was enjoying vigorous health.

Another application was that wishes would come true if a person burnt onion skins on a fire. Sometimes the onions had to be placed on the altar at Christmas before they had any divine significance.
